Subject: DR drill Thursday — heads up for reviewers

Hi all — quick note before Thursday's disaster-recovery drill for Gleamtrace, our GPU memory profiler. Reviewers, please hold merges during the window; the restore scripts touch the profiling agents. If the drill runner prompts you to unlock the backup snapshot, enter the recovery passphrase shown below.

vault phrase of yagag-kadup = belael-druius-rusax-kelox

Any change to the elevator-dispatch simulator's core scheduling algorithms, car-assignment heuristics, or passenger-load models requires a formal approval before merge. Open a review request, attach the simulation benchmark report comparing wait times against the baseline scenario suite, and wait for explicit sign-off. Documentation-only and test-only changes may be self-approved after a second reviewer glances at them. For everything else, approval authority rests with a single designated owner, whose name appears below.

signatory, fafog-bagef: Jorwyn Juleth Pelius

Quarterly Planning Note – Marketing Budget Adjustment

To all branch managers. Group marketing spend for next quarter is reduced by 18% following the portfolio review. Local print and event budgets are most affected; digital campaigns under the Brightmere programme continue at current levels. Branches should resubmit local plans within two weeks, prioritising proven channels. Central support for co-funded promotions is suspended pending review. The rationale tied to broader plans follows below.

internal memo for kawip-hadug: Headcount on the Wenwyn team goes from 7 to 140 by the end of January. Gross margin on Wenwyn came in at 20 percent against a plan of 15 percent.

Ticket: Staging env misconfigured for Siftgate bloom filter

The bloom layer in front of the Pellet KV store is rejecting all lookups in staging because the env file was copied from the dev template without credentials. False-positive tuning values are fine; only the auth line is missing. To unblock the weekly demo, the Pellet admission secret must be set on the following line.

env line for yaguf-fajop: LEDGER_TOKEN13=fb08984397349